    Malaysia was the second Southeast Asian country I've visited outside of the Philippines. The capital (Kuala Lumpur) is widely recognized for numerous landmarks, including the Petronas Twin Towers (twin skyscrapers with a sky bridge and observation deck), the Petaling Street flea market, and Batu Caves, which are over 400 million years old. The official language of Kuala Lumpur is Malaysian, which is also referred to as Malaysian Malay or simply just Malay. This is spoken by the majority of the people in Kuala Lumpur, closely followed by the English language.
